Hardwood Replacement in Davidsonville, MD
Hardwood replacement services involve removing damaged, worn, or outdated hardwood flooring and installing new planks to restore the appearance and functionality of a property’s floors. These projects typically cover areas such as living rooms, hallways, kitchens, and bedrooms, where hardwood flooring has experienced significant wear, water damage, or structural issues. Property owners often seek hardwood replacement when repairs to existing flooring are no longer feasible or when they want to update the style or finish of their floors to better match their interior design.
Before requesting hardwood replacement services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the condition of the subfloor, the type of hardwood available, and the expected durability of different wood species. It’s also helpful to consider the overall style and finish preferences, as well as any necessary preparations such as removing furniture or existing flooring. Clarifying these details can ensure the new hardwood installation aligns with the property's needs and aesthetic goals.

Common Hardwood Replacement Jobs
Hardwood Replacement - involves removing damaged or outdated hardwood flooring and installing new planks to restore appearance and function.
Floorboard Replacement - addresses loose or broken boards to ensure a smooth, even surface.
Whole Floor Replacement - replaces an entire hardwood floor for significant wear, damage, or style updates.
Partial Replacement - focuses on replacing specific sections of hardwood flooring due to localized damage or staining.
Refinishing and Resurfacing - restores the look of existing hardwood by sanding and applying fresh finish, often combined with replacement.
Custom Hardwood Installations - includes pattern or inlay work to enhance aesthetic appeal during replacement projects.
